
Milwaukee-based, Black woman-owned positive news company Carvd N Stone has partnered with Amazon to launch an exclusive story series.
Carvd N Stone, founded by Nyesha Stone, is a news and marketing agency centered on positive news. Her company has grown exponentially since its founding around eight years ago with its impact across the country. Stone has been looking for larger partnerships and ultimately found connections to Amazon to produce the special story series after she attended a career fair held by the National Association of Black Journalists (NABJ).
“This partnership with Amazon is taking another step up,” Stone said. “So I really just hope that this continues to happen. I hope this encourages other corporations in Wisconsin to see the value of our positive news and help us partner.”
Amazon had a booth at the career fair where Stone struck up a conversation. Talks went great between the two with some back-and-forth conversations for a potential partnership over a few months. The partnership marks the biggest between Carvd N Stone yet.
“That was the first time, me going to NABJ, and I’m actually getting something career-wise out of it,” Stone said. “I’ve been going since college and trying to get a job. This was the time… just going and really enjoying the benefits of the panels and meeting people. I had a different outlook on the convention.”
The partnership entails a series of stories highlighting people associated with Amazon. It will give an inside look at its employees and small businesses that have been impacted by the company.
The series will offer a more intimate human look at the people who make up the tech giant instead of thinking of Amazon as a company.
The series will release sometime later this month or possibly next. Continued releases will come out through the months that follow its launch.
